Transaction 86e327627a39c5cdbf9754bf169297f1252bd63f740d92d3f91d93a5d9e5e287
1 Input
1 Output
-
86e327627a39c5cdbf9754bf169297f1252bd63f740d92d3f91d93a5d9e5e287:0
- value
- 1767224
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a8f008003f785756d371a07109aac31c80cdb7d7 OP_EQUAL
- address
- 3H6GzSC7s2HYLkEhM9gN9H5qmyb7U7UMZN